11.1 of the 17.3 miles in are maintained only for high-clearance vehicles, 9.9 miles of it dirt. Climbs 3,100 ft over 17.3 miles through 10 switchbacks, with sustained grades near 14% and pitches to 20%. Stretches run along a shelf with a drop of up to ~140 ft on the downhill side. Dead-end road with no mapped turnaround, so expect to back out or unhitch.

Dixie Peak stands 1,504 ft above the site, 0.8 miles south. Exposed here, with the nearest through road 0.0 miles off. Lost Branch runs 0.6 mi off.

Kootenai National Forest, Cabinet Ranger District: Camping or otherwise occupying a single site for over 16 consecutive days within a calendar year. Camping or otherwise occupying any number of sites over 32 cumulative days within a calendar year.
